The Super Tilting Hurlacoaster,
Sixty stories high!
A terror ride that's sure to thrill,
And churn up your insides!
With eight gigantic loop-de-loops,
And five, three-mile long dips,
It nose-dives through the tightest bends,
White-knuckles cling the grips!
Through gravity-defying spins,
A total of sixteen,
This palpitating, pitching trip,
Will leave you shades of green!
The Super Tilting Hurlacoaster,
Threw me to and fro,
Now I'm queasy, faint and dizzy,
Can I have another go?
